Best table top wood planer Buying guide
When selecting a table top wood planer, it is important to consider your needs and the features of the planer.
Size – Table top planers come in a variety of sizes, so it is important to select one that will fit your workspace. For example, if you have a small workshop, it is best to select a model that is compact and lightweight.
Power – Look for a planer with a powerful motor so it can handle the toughest jobs. The motor should also be durable and reliable so it can last for many years.
Cutting Depth – Make sure the planer has a cutting depth that is appropriate for your project. The deeper the cutting depth, the more material the planer can handle.
Dust Collection – Dust collection is important for a clean and safe work environment. Look for a planer that has an effective dust collection system.
Noise Level – Table top wood planers can be quite loud, so you should look for one that is quiet and won’t disturb your neighbors.
Price – Price is always an important factor when shopping for any tool. Consider your budget and make sure you select a planer that is within your price range.
